KANAGAWA, May 06 (News On Japan) –
A drunken man precipitated a disturbance at a preferred ramen chain in Kanagawa Prefecture on May 2nd, kicking towards the kitchen space and shouting calls for over a big serving he claimed he was denied.
The incident occurred round 7:50 a.m. throughout Golden Week and was captured on video by a buyer who had stopped in for an early morning bowl of ramen, a observe often called “asa-ra” (morning ramen). The footage reveals the person standing on a desk, repeatedly kicking within the course of the kitchen, whereas three staff try and restrain him.
Interestingly, the person appeared to have eliminated his footwear earlier than the outburst, together with his sock-clad ft clearly seen within the video. The witness who filmed the scene speculated, “He was on the tatami floor, so I think he took off his shoes before kicking.”
According to the witness, the person was alone at a tatami-seat desk when he abruptly shouted “Hey!” loudly sufficient to startle others. He then moved from his seat to kick aggressively towards the kitchen space.
The restaurant reported the incident to police. Authorities confirmed that the person was closely intoxicated and had been shouting, “Why won’t you serve me a large portion?”
The ramen store, recognized for its wealthy pork bone broth and principally 24-hour operation, attracts a gradual circulation of consumers, particularly throughout holidays. The witness expressed frustration on the disruption, saying, “It was a real nuisance. I really don’t want him coming back to this ramen shop.”
